At its Nov. 6, 2025 strategic planning session the Maroa Forsyth CUSD 2 board reached consensus to adopt a new mission, vision and six core values; board members present included Parker, Feinstein, Wise, Lidy and Crawford.

The Maroa Forsyth CUSD 2 strategic planning session on Nov. 6, 2025 opened with the board calling the meeting to order at 6:06 p.m. and recording a roll call that listed Parker, Feinstein, Wise, Lidy and Crawford as present and Conway and Zuniga as absent. The group reviewed and approved a new Mission, Vision and Motto: "Cultivate a learning environment that empowers all students to reach their unique potential" (Mission); "To be the premier destination district" (Vision); and the Motto: "Excellence and Pride."

The session also recorded that "Consensus was reached on: Mission, Vision, Core Values (6)." Board members and staff discussed the significance of approving values now and returning later with specific action steps. The meeting minutes list the board members present and note follow-up work to refine the wording before final implementation.
